Subject: Handover — failed exports on Kestrelbase

Taking off at 6. Nightly exports for the Marlow feed failed three times; looks like transient timeouts, not data issues. Retry script is at /opt/kestrel/retry_exports.sh — run it with --batch nightly. If it fails twice more, bump the statement timeout to 120s and retry once. Log everything in the Fennwick channel. Connect directly to the replica using the string below.

replica DSN, kajep-yahag: mssql://praok_svc:iF@db-8d68.plorvaio.local:5432/eliion

## Resharding the profile store

If Pindrop's user-profile store starts throwing hot-shard alerts, don't panic — the rebalancer handles most of it. Your job is to kick off the split, watch replication lag, and hold off any schema migrations until it settles. Splits usually take under an hour; page the storage folks if lag climbs past ten minutes. Before starting, double-check the rebalancer is running with the following configuration values.

config for kafof-bawef:
holath:
  log_level: debug
  metrics_host: metrics.holath.qorvelsys.internal
  pin: 2191
  pool_size: 32

# Cold Storage Archival — notes for the weekly eng sync (Team Permafrost)
# This config governs the nightly sweep that moves buckets untouched for 180+
# days from the Tarnwell hot tier into Glacierpoint cold storage. Please review
# ARCHIVE_BATCH_SIZE carefully before changing it; batches over 500 objects
# have caused manifest timeouts twice this quarter. Restores must go through
# the ops queue, never directly. The sweep job authenticates to the
# Glacierpoint API with the key declared on the next line.

secret setting of kagug-tajep: COURIER_KEY8=e81a8675

### Submitting Crash Reports

The Gullwing crash pipeline ingests reports from the mobile SDK the moment an app relaunches after a crash. Each report gets symbolicated on the Tidepool workers, deduplicated, and filed into an issue cluster — you'll mostly interact with the clusters endpoint, not raw reports. Pagination is cursor-based, and responses are gzipped, so set your client accordingly. All requests to the ingestion and query endpoints must include the bearer token below.

session JWT of yawep-yawep = eyJhbGciOiJIUzI1NiIsInR5cCI6IkpXVCJ9.eyJzdWIiOiI3pWF3_In0.aXYsHiog